Mission Statement

Valley Outreach is a bridge between the crisis of the moment and the solution of the future. We help our St. Croix Valley neighbors in need of food, clothing, emergency financial assistance, and other support while respecting their individual dignity and offering them encouragement and hope.

Description

What started as the St. Croix Valley Emergency Food Shelf in 1983 has grown into the place our neighbors turn to during challenging times. Today Valley Outreach is the only non-profit in the valley that provides clients with a range of support - whether they need food, clothing, and personalized client services.

We’ve learned a lot in 35 years, but nothing more important than this: everybody needs help. And as long as there is need, Valley Outreach will be here - taking care of our community, and making us all a little healthier, stronger and more stable.

Valley Outreach is a community based, community-supported, privately funded non-profit organization serving our St. Croix Valley neighbors in need of food, clothing, and emergency financial assistance. Our Food Shelf provides food and other necessities. The Clothing Closet provides gently used clothing at no cost to men, women and children. Our Emergency Fund provides emergency financial assistance to help families in crisis.
